THE LITTLE THINGS

With 3 Academy Award Winning actors, THE LITTLE THINGS follows former Los Angeles detective Joe Deacon (Denzel Washington) and new department hotshot Jim Baxter (Rami Malek) on the trail of accused serial killer Albert Sparma (Jared Leto). Obviously the cast and trailer hook you into this film and it's Leto who shines the brightest. The villains always has the most fun and here Leto enjoys playing in that sandbox. Teasing the police, attempting to outsmart them, all the while not being completely stable and the audience is left wondering if this man is a mad genius or just a few cards short of a full deck? Denzel is smooth as ever as a tired, rugged, now county sheriff, after being run off his LA detective job 5 years prior. Malek is the only one who seems hollow and robotic, not displaying a lot of emotion except for a few outbursts here and there. There is not a lot of violence in the film as the victims are all shown after their murder, which was an interesting choice. They dumb it down for the audience, but at the same time, you're left wondering as much as Deacon and Baxter if Sparma is really their man (even up until the final credits). A decent film that wasn't as great as I was hoping for but worth the watch (especially if you have HBO Max). 6/10
